What is a polygon?

A polygon is a planar figure defined by a limited number of straight line segments joined to create a closed polygonal chain in geometry (or polygonal circuit). A polygon can be specified as a bounding circuit, a bounded planar area, or both.

The segments are the edges or sides of a polygonal circuit. The vertices (singular: vertex) or corners of a polygon are the spots where two edges meet. A solid polygon’s interior is sometimes referred to as its body. A polygon with n sides is called an n-gon; for example, a triangle is a 3-gon.

A simple polygon is one that has no points that intersect. Mathematicians are frequently just interested in the bounding polygonal chains of basic polygons, and they define a polygon in this way. Star polygons and other self-intersecting polygons can be created when a polygonal boundary is allowed to cross over itself.

A polygon is a two-dimensional representation of the polytope, which can have any number of dimensions. There are many more polygon generalizations defined for various reasons.

Classification

Convexity and intersection

The convexity or non-convexity of polygons can be characterized as follows:

  • Any line traced through the polygon that is not tangent to an edge or corner crosses its boundary twiceAs a result, none of the inner angles are more than 180°. Any line segment with boundary endpoints travels through only interior locations between its endpoints, or vice versa.

  • Non-convex: a line that encounters its border more than twice can be discovered. Between two border points that travel outside the polygon, or vice versa, a line segment occurs.

Equality and symmetry

  • Equiangular means that all corner angles are the same.

  • Equilateral means that all of the edges are the same length.

  • Equilateral and equiangular regularity.

  • A single circumcircle connects all four corners, making it cyclic.

  • All edges of an inscribed circle are tangent to it.

  • All corners of the symmetry orbit are isogonal or vertex-transitive. In addition, the polygon is cyclic and equiangular.

  • All sides of the symmetry orbit are isotoxal or edge-transitive. The polygon is also tangential and equilateral.

How Polygons are Used in Daily Life Situations

Real life applications of polygons are:

  • The squared form of the tiles you walk on indicates that they are polygons.

  • The truss of a construction or bridge, the walls of a building, and so on are all polygons. The trusses are triangular, whereas the walls are rectangular.

  • A polygon is the rectangular portion of a chair on which you are seated.

  • A polygon is the rectangular-shaped screen on your laptop, television, or mobile phone.

  • A polygon is an example of a rectangular football pitch or playground.

  • The Bermuda Triangle is a polygon with a triangle form.

  • Polygons may also be seen in Egypt’s Pyramids (triangular)

  • A polygon is a figure with a star form.

  • Polygons can also be found on road signs.

  • A polygon is a modeling and rendering primitive in computer graphics.

Importance of Polygons

The variety of polygon forms commonly used in the construction of modern constructions would most likely explain their relevance. Because of its reasonably strong design, the triangle is commonly used in construction. The usage of the polygon form minimizes the amount of resources used to construct a structure, lowering costs and increasing profits in a corporate setting. The rectangle is another polygon. Because our field of view is predominantly rectangular, the rectangle is used in a variety of applications. Most televisions, for example, are rectangular to make watching easier and more enjoyable. Photo frames and phone screens are in the same boat.
